Casric Stars head coach and Chairman Bucs Mthombeni has addressed suggestions that he's an avid Orlando Pirates supporter.

This comes after the Motsepe Foundation Championship outfit dumped the Soweto giants out of the Nedbank Cup in the Round of 16 following a 5-4 penalty shootout victory on Saturday.

When quizzed after the match on whether he's a Pirates fan, Mthombeni poured cold water on the suggestions, but confirmed a plethora of his family members do support the club.

“My late mom was a number one Pirates fan, and then my uncle, Moses the late Mahlangu, I think you may know him, he was a very close friend to Jomo Sono, he was a Pirates fan. I think he recruited most of my family members to be Orlando Pirates fans,” said the Casric boss.

"But I was the only neutral one because I wanted to pursue my dream of coaching, I said I'd rather stay neutral. And my son, the same goalkeeper who kept a clean sheet, is a Pirates fan, and my other son Mondli Mthombeni is a Pirates fan.

"Now they are recruiting everybody in the family to be a Pirates fan. What makes me more excited for the boys - I dedicate this win to them because at home it's only me and my wife who are neutral, but everybody is a Pirates fan.

“And this boy, the players had a doubt about him to start, Wandile Mthombeni, they asked if he's sure he will give it all. I jokingly said, ‘You signed a contract, if ever you cannot commit yourself here, I think your job is going to be on the line.”

He added: "But definitely most of the family members are Pirates fans, even my younger brother is a Pirates fan. He even decided that he's not coming to the stadium because he didn't know where he's going to stand.

Meanwhile, Casric will await their fate in the quarter-finals, with the draw set to be conducted on Monday evening.
